ALLEGED SHEEP-STEALING.

FARMER ARRESTED; " By Telegraph.—Press Association Marton, Last Night. The police arrested to-day Rudolph Edward Krecgher, a well-known farmer! of Haleoinbe, on a charge of the alleged theft in June last of 86 sheep, the property of James Howard, of the Weatoe Kstatc, Grcatford. The accused will be brought before the Court to-morrow.
